Top 5 Brown Bass of 2023
The Smallmouth Bass (Micropterus dolomieu) aka Brown Bass, is a fascinating and highly sought-after game fish, renowned for its spirited fight and captivating beauty. Found predominantly in North America, this remarkable species thrives in a variety of aquatic environments, including clear, rocky streams, and deeper, cool waters of lakes and reservoirs. As a prized catch among anglers, the Smallmouth Bass has captivated the hearts of many, inspiring a fervent passion for sport fishing and a deep appreciation for the richness of freshwater ecosystems. I did a similar thread last season, https://www.bassresource.com/bass-fishing-forums/topic/252116-top-5-brown-bass-of-2022/ And even though this year is technically not 'over', my personal hunt for these beauties most certainly is. Got 2 inches of snow on the ground this morning with plenty more on the way. So the final stats for 2023 were, fish at 5.66lbs, 5.68lbs, 5.84 lbs 5.98 lbs, and big fish of the year was 6.06 lbs For a top 5 weight of 29.22 lbs. Includes a 5.84 lb average and is 6.7 oz lighter than last years best 5 smallies. Interestingly, all these brutes were caught between the 3rd week in Apr and the 1st week in May. And ALL on jerkbaits. (more on that in the up coming 'Most Productive Baits' thread. And while I was most fortunate to tangle with and land several very respectable smallies though Aug, Sept & early Oct, none of them had the tonnage needed to displace any fish on the list above. And so there it is. Another one in the books. Looking forward to next season as I've been scouting hard some new to me versions of Lake Menderchuck. Early next season will prove if my efforts & instincts pay off or not. Finally, it's a long winter, so please add any & all of the your own brown bass pictures here. The addiction is real.
